20. Difficult Homecomings

Returning home from Afghanistan was often a bittersweet and challenging experience for soldiers. The transition back to civilian life was filled with obstacles—coping with trauma, reuniting with family, and navigating a society that sometimes struggled to understand their sacrifices. Many veterans felt isolated or misunderstood, carrying invisible wounds long after the conflict ended. As a community, recognizing these struggles and supporting those who served is crucial.
